What We Actually Do

We bring in a stump grinder – a machine with a spinning carbide-tipped wheel that chews the stump down to wood chips. We grind below the soil surface (typically 4-6 inches down, deeper if you need it for replanting) so you’re left with a flat area you can fill, seed, or build on.

The wood chips left behind? You can use them as mulch, we can haul them away, or we can fill the hole and leave things tidy. Your call.

The whole process is faster and less invasive than digging out a stump, which would mean tearing up a much larger section of your lawn to get at the roots.

 

When Stump Grinding Makes Sense

You want to reclaim the space. Maybe you’re planning a garden bed, a shed, a pool, or just a flat lawn where kids can run around without watching their feet.

It’s a tripping hazard. Stumps near walkways, driveways, or play areas are accidents waiting to happen – especially once grass starts growing around them and they become harder to see.

You’re selling the house. Nothing says “deferred maintenance” like old stumps scattered around a property. Grinding them is a small investment that makes the yard look finished.

Pests are moving in. Rotting stumps attract termites, carpenter ants, and beetles. If the stump is close to your house, that’s not the company you want.

You’re just tired of mowing around it. Honestly, this is reason enough.

 

Stump Grinding vs. Complete Stump Removal

Stump grinding handles the visible problem – the part above and just below the surface. The roots stay in the ground but will decay naturally over time.

Complete stump removal means excavating the entire root ball, which requires heavier equipment, more labor, and leaves you with a much bigger hole to fill. It costs more and tears up more of your yard.

For most residential situations, grinding is the practical choice. If you have a specific reason to remove the entire root system – like roots that are damaging a foundation or you’re doing major construction – we can talk through that option too.

What About the Roots?

The roots left behind after grinding will break down over the next several years. They won’t send up new shoots (the tree is dead), and they won’t keep growing.

If you have roots that are already causing problems—lifting sidewalks, cracking driveways, getting into pipes – that’s a separate service called root cutting. We handle that too. Just let us know what you’re dealing with and we’ll figure out the right approach.

Cost Factors

Every stump is different. What affects the price:

  • Size – A 12-inch stump is a quicker job than a 36-inch oak.
  • Location – Stumps near fences, foundations, or utilities take more care.
  • Number of stumps – Doing several at once is more efficient, so the per-stump cost goes down.
  • Root flare – Some trees have wide surface roots that add to the grinding area.
  • Access – If we can’t get equipment close, it takes longer.
